Output 15851310d2491076ce8f22e11fe27c37502e75373d36a9b3e1e8e6bf223b5bad:13

value
98118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c278ec6717ed83173cd1ce8e35ba62aaaf3d0e57 OP_EQUAL
address
3KRHsff8SCz8E7Gpej9hFuPeUAUJJssS3o
transaction
15851310d2491076ce8f22e11fe27c37502e75373d36a9b3e1e8e6bf223b5bad
confirmations
174770
spent
true